Thousands still fleeing Sudan conflict daily, one year on: UN

By Robin MILLARD GENEVA, April 9, 2024 (AFP) – One year since the conflict in Sudan erupted, thousands of desperate people are still fleeing the country daily “as if the emergency had started yesterday”, the UN said Tuesday. Two Rohingya found dead at sea after Indonesia ends survivor search

ACEH JAYA, Indonesia, March 23, 2024 (AFP) – The bodies of two Rohingya refugees were retrieved and several more were spotted at sea Saturday, local rescuers said, days after a wooden boat believed to be carrying around 150 people capsized, leaving many missing or dead. Rescuers end sea search for Rohingya refugees

By Zahlul Akbar MEULABOH, Indonesia, March 22, 2024 (AFP) – Indonesian rescuers called off the search for Rohingya refugees missing at sea after their boat capsized, despite reports from some of the survivors that dozens of people were swept away. UN urges rescue of 185 Rohingya adrift in Indian Ocean

GENEVA, Dec 23, 2023 (AFP) – The United Nations called Saturday for the urgent rescue of 185 people, mainly women and children, on a distressed boat last heard to be near the Andaman and Nicobar Islands in the Indian Ocean. Nearly 200 Rohingya stranded on Indonesia beach: AFP

BANDA ACEH, Indonesia, Dec 10, 2023 (AFP) – Nearly 200 Rohingya refugees, mostly women and children, were stranded on a beach in western Indonesia Sunday after local authorities said they would not accept the new arrivals, AFP witnessed. The refugees arrived by boat at 3:00 am local time (2000 GMT Saturday), the latest in what has been the largest influx of the persecuted Myanmar minority since 2015. Over 100 Rohingya refugees land in Indonesia, 2 more boats at sea

By Chaideer Mahyuddin SABANG, Indonesia, Dec 2, 2023 (AFP) – More than 100 Rohingya refugees, including women and children, landed in Indonesia’s westernmost province on Saturday, officials said, but locals threatened to push them back to sea. Hundreds more of the mostly Muslim Rohingya from Myanmar were trapped on board another two unseaworthy vessels adrift in the Andaman Sea, according to the United Nations Refugee Agency (UNHCR). Nearly 200 Rohingya refugees land in Indonesia: official

BANDA ACEH, Indonesia, Nov 14, 2023 (AFP) – Nearly 200 Rohingya refugees, including many women and children, landed in Indonesia’s westernmost province on Tuesday, a local official said, the largest contingent of the persecuted Myanmar minority to arrive in months. Thousands of the mostly Muslim Rohingya risk their lives each year on long and expensive sea journeys, often in flimsy boats, to try to reach Malaysia or Indonesia. More than 1 million displaced since Myanmar coup: UN

Yangon, Myanmar (AFP) More than one million people have been displaced in Myanmar since the military coup last year, the United Nations children’s agency has said. The Southeast Asian nation has been in turmoil since the military ousted Aung San Suu Kyi’s government last year, sparking widespread armed resistance. Japan minister brings Ukrainians from Poland on government plane

TOKYO, Japan (AFP) — Twenty Ukrainians arrived in Tokyo Tuesday on a government plane with Foreign Minister Yoshimasa Hayashi after his trip to Poland, as Japan cautiously welcomes those fleeing Moscow’s invasion. Japan typically accepts just a few dozen refugees a year from thousands of applicants, and while it has cracked open its doors to Ukrainians, it calls them “evacuees” rather than refugees. More than 4.2 million Ukrainian refugees flee war

by Robin MILLARD GENEVA, Switzerland (AFP) — More than 4.2 million Ukrainian refugees have now fled the country since the Russian invasion, the United Nations said Monday, adding that the humanitarian situation was worsening. Australia accepts N.Zealand offer to take 450 refugees after long delay

SYDNEY, Australia (AFP) – Australia accepted on Thursday a long-standing New Zealand offer to take hundreds of refugees detained for years in remote camps under Canberra’s “Pacific solution” immigration policy.
